19TH CENTURY OTTOMAN YATAGHAN SWORD
AN OTTOMAN YATAGHAN SWORDOttoman Turkey, late 19th century With a curved single-edged blade, embellished with silver inlay emblem, etched script and engraved decoration, the copper forte decorated with glass beads and engraved geometric motifs, the tang's ridge encrusted with drop-shaped coral to the top and red glass beads to the bottom, the walrus ivory grip plates and large extended 'ears' characteristic of the weapon type, housed in a scabbard of leather over wood, with brass fittings, overall length in scabbard 77cm.This item may require Export or CITES licences in order to leave the UK or the European Union.
